So this wingnut sends a "Hyuk-Hyuk Global Warming My Ass" email because of our weird cold spring…

My reply:

I long ago told you that temperature variance increases much faster than the mean. This means that "global warming" manifests as crazy weather patterns rather than as simple increases in temperature. The current weather pattern is due to perturbations in the global jet stream brought about by the earth absorbing more heat in certain places than in others. It is actually further proof of GW. The disproof of GW theory would be a return to normal conditions, with "normal" meaning the way it was in the period of maybe 200 to 50 years ago. You're like the guy standing at the rail of a sinking ship that is beginning to roll over. You feel yourself temporarily rising & therefore refuse to get into a lifeboat because you don't believe that the ship is sinking.
